Service

Always remove the battery pack before
adjusting, cleaning, repairing, or storing to
prevent unintended starting Such preventative
safety measures reduce the risk of starting the
lawnmower accidentally
Cleaning is never to be done by children and only
by adults familiar with the product
Store Idle Lawnmower Indoors – When not in use,
lawnmower should be stored in an indoor dry and
locked-up place – out of reach of children
Keep guards in place and in working order
Keep blades sharp
Use identical replacement blades only Use of any
other accessory or attachment might increase the
risk of injury
Keep all nuts and bolts tight to be sure the
equipment is in safe working condition
Never remove or tamper with safety devices
Check their proper operation regularly Never do
anything to interfere with the intended function
of a safety device or to reduce the protection
provided by a safety device
Keep machine free of grass, leaves, or other debris
build up
If you strike a foreign object, stop and inspect the
machine Repair, if necessary, before starting
Never make any adjustments or repairs with the
motor running
Check grass catcher components and the
discharge guard frequently and replace with
manufacturer's recommended parts, when
necessary
Ensure that all replacement or service parts are
approved by the manufacturer
Mower blades are sharp Wrap the blade or wear
gloves, and use extra caution when servicing
them

Battery Packs and Charging

Do not charge battery pack in rain, or in wet
locations Keep the battery charger away from rain
or moisture Penetration of water in the battery
charger increases the risk of an electric shock
Do not use battery-operated lawnmower in rain
Remove or disconnect battery before servicing,
cleaning, or removing material from the
lawnmower
Use lawnmower only with Oregon Series B
specifically designated battery packs B425E,
B600E, or B650E Use of any other battery packs
may create a risk of injury and fire
Recharge only with the charger specified by the
manufacturer, Oregon C600, C650, or C750 A
charger that is suitable for one type of battery
pack may create a risk of fire when used with
another battery pack
Do not charge other batteries on the charger
The battery charger is suitable only for charging
manufacturer specific and approved lithium
ion batteries within the listed voltage range
Otherwise there is danger of fire and explosion
Before each use, check the battery charger, cable
and plug If damage is detected, do not use the
battery charger Never open the battery charger
yourself Have repairs performed only by a
qualified technician and only using original spare
parts Damaged battery chargers, cables and
plugs increase the risk of an electric shock
Keep the battery charger clean Contamination can
lead to danger of an electric shock
Occasionally clean the venting slots of the battery
using a soft, clean and dry brush
